Position: PartnerA solicitor for over eighteen years, Paul has worked in-house for two national firms and for the last eight years been a partner at Keeble Hawson.
Paul deals with work covering the full range of contentious and non-contentious issues. His clients, who he has served loyally for many years, range from small owner managed businesses to plcs.
Paul regularly appears in employment tribunals across the UK and advises on many aspects of employment law – including unfair/wrongful dismissal, race, sex and disability discrimination, redundancy and reorganisation. Food retail is also a specialist area Paul has experience and expertise in.
He believes that partner led involvement with clients at all times and a small, connected team are the real strengths to his team, their excellent service delivery and the reason why his client-base continues to expand.
Paul is a regular contributor of articles to the media and clients. A recent work was the Practical Guide to Disciplinary and Dismissal procedures that addressed the employment law changes from April 6th 2009.
He is also a member of the Employment Lawyers Association.
